The main elements of the new equity crowdfunding exception are: The most common types of intellectual property are patents, copyrights and trademarks.
It is important to be able to distinguish between these types of intellectual property and who « owns » the property. For example, a new product requires a patent; A movie or song needs copyright; And a name or logo needs a trademark. A startup must protect its intellectual property before it is shared on a crowdfunding site. (There are several documented examples of « patentable » products being « stolen » from crowdfunding websites.) There are different pros and cons to each type of business structure, but it`s important for businesses looking for crowdfunding to start a business and get a business bank account from the start (rather than working as a sole proprietor by default). Some corporate structures will also help protect founders from personal liability. LLCs are a common structure for companies looking for crowdfunding.

Fundraising for your business on a crowdfunding platform is a contract between you and anyone who supports your campaign. In most cases, a contract is a good thing, but in today`s crowdfunding world, the terms between the business owner and backers are usually vague. For this reason, you should be as specific as possible when describing the reward you will offer.
In addition, you need to ensure that the reward is a reward that you can reasonably fulfill (i.e. perform a thorough analysis of the potential cost of performing each reward). You can be sued if you fail to meet your obligations under the campaign. Washington State has filed the first consumer protection lawsuit against a business owner who used Kickstarter to raise money.
